Ragnarok Origin Classic’s Million Dollar Tyr Cup S1 Ends with ENCORE Crowned Champion

Ragnarok Origin Classic (ROOC) has officially concluded its inaugural Million Dollar Tyr Cup Season 1, marking a major milestone for the game’s growing esports ecosystem. Held on July 11, 2026, at Union Mall in Bangkok, the Grand Final brought together the strongest teams from across the competition to battle for championship glory and a share of the tournament’s massive prize pool.

After months of intense competition, the tournament culminated in a showdown between Poek from Indonesia and ENCORE from the Philippines. Both teams showcased exceptional teamwork, strategic execution, and determination throughout the event, but it was ENCORE that ultimately emerged victorious. The Philippine squad secured a dominant 4-0 victory to become the first-ever Tyr Cup champions, taking home the grand prize of US$500,000 along with the prestigious Champion’s Medal.

Record-Breaking Numbers for RO Esports

The inaugural Tyr Cup achieved unprecedented results for the Ragnarok franchise.

According to tournament statistics:

  • 333,352 adventurers participated.
  • Players came from 19 different regions.
  • A total of 29,472 teams entered the competition.
  • More than 1,012,099 matches were played throughout the tournament.

These numbers established new records for RO esports and demonstrated the immense enthusiasm surrounding competitive play within the community.

Tyr Cup Global Officially Announced

Following the conclusion of Season 1, organizers revealed the next chapter of ROOC esports with the announcement of Tyr Cup Global.

The new competition will unite players from both the Asia and Americas servers and once again feature a prize pool exceeding US$1,000,000. Tyr Cup Global will introduce guild-based competition built around three major battlefields: Stellar Clash, Vale of Clash, and Vigrid Avenge.

Using a structured Tier A and Tier B League system, the tournament aims to provide guilds of all sizes with an opportunity to compete on a fair and competitive stage while pursuing prestige, rewards, and championship titles.

In addition to cash prizes, participants will also have opportunities to earn rare items, exclusive cosmetics, and prestigious recognition within the ROOC community.
